Overview:
The Royal Society of Chemistry has several international offices around the world in addition to its headquarters in the UK. Within China it has two offices in Beijing and Shanghai and currently employs ~20 people carrying out various activities including organising symposia and conferences, visiting universities and industry, publishing and sales. This role, as part of the wider team, will work closely with Publishing, Membership, Digital, Event & Marketing and Sales teams. Projects will include events (visits, workshops, symposia, conferences), membership support and development, student engagement and other activities.
The role will require travel throughout China and occasionally internationally.

英国皇家化学会 (Royal Society of Chemistry, RSC) 成立于 1841 年,拥有超过 5 万名会员,是全球最具影响力的化学专业团体和信息传播机构之一。英国皇家化学会出版 40 余种高水平的化学及相关学科领域的学术期刊以及图书、数据库和杂志。英国皇家化学会旗下的学术期刊不仅以前沿的科研论文和权威的研究综述享誉全球化学界,更因其严谨的科学态度、公正的同行评审、迅捷的出版速度而广受好评。
英国皇家化学会也是一家非营利性的出版机构,其业务盈余均用于支持科学工作者的交流和推进化学科学的发展,包括举办国际性学术会议、为会员和化学科研人员提供支持、促进化学教育以及向公众传播化学知识等。
英国皇家化学会总部位于英国伦敦和剑桥,同时在世界多地拥有数个国际办公室。在中国目前有北京、上海两个办公室。
